Introduction
Pay-Per-Click (PPC) advertising is often dominated by big brands with large budgets, making smaller businesses feel overshadowed. However, niche markets offer an entirely different playing field where smaller companies can achieve remarkable results. With the right targeting, creativity, and strategy, businesses can use PPC to outperform competitors and reach highly specific audiences.

1. Understanding the Power of Niche PPC

  • Niche markets focus on very specific customer groups rather than broad audiences.
  • Unlike big brands, small businesses can tap into hyper-focused keywords that directly match customer intent.
  • PPC allows you to bid on long-tail keywords that are cheaper but more relevant, increasing ROI.
  • For example, instead of bidding on “shoes,” a niche brand can focus on “eco-friendly vegan running shoes.”
  • This precise targeting reduces wasted ad spend and attracts customers who are ready to buy.

2. Crafting Highly Relevant Ad Copy

  • Niche audiences expect brands to speak directly to their needs.
  • Ad copy should highlight unique benefits and solve specific pain points.
  • Adding power words like “exclusive,” “handcrafted,” or “natural” resonates with niche buyers.
  • Highlighting values such as sustainability, customization, or cultural relevance strengthens ad appeal.
  • Using ad extensions like sitelinks, callouts, and structured snippets increases visibility and CTR.

3. Leveraging Geo-Targeting and Demographics

  • Big brands often run broad campaigns, but niche businesses can win by being selective.
  • Geo-targeting allows ads to reach audiences in specific cities, regions, or even neighborhoods.
  • Demographic filters ensure ads appear to the right age group, income level, or interest category.
  • For example, a boutique plant nursery can target ads only to urban apartment dwellers searching for “indoor low-maintenance plants.”
  • This precise targeting maximizes ad performance and reduces wasted impressions.

4. Optimizing Landing Pages for Conversions

  • A well-optimized landing page is crucial for niche PPC campaigns.
  • Content should directly reflect the ad promise to ensure consistency.
  • Clear CTAs like “Shop Now,” “Book a Free Demo,” or “Get Your Custom Plan” guide users.
  • Adding testimonials, niche-specific FAQs, and trust signals boosts credibility.
  • Fast-loading, mobile-friendly pages improve user experience and lower bounce rates.

5. Measuring Performance and Scaling Success

  • Tracking performance metrics like CTR, conversion rate, and cost per acquisition is essential.
  • A/B testing ad creatives helps refine messaging for better results.
  • Retargeting campaigns ensure potential buyers who showed interest return to complete purchases.
  • Once a winning campaign is identified, it can be scaled gradually to expand reach without losing focus.
  • Continual analysis ensures campaigns adapt to changing market behaviors.

Conclusion
PPC for niche markets isn’t about competing with big brands on budget but about leveraging precision, creativity, and strategy. By focusing on specific keywords, tailoring ad copy, using geo-targeting, optimizing landing pages, and analyzing performance, niche businesses can achieve impressive results. When executed properly, PPC becomes a growth engine for brands operating in specialized spaces.
